There are three basic requirements that the case should have. First, it must protect the 3.5 inch multi-touch display. Using a screen protector is not enough. The case must completely cover the entire screen whenever I am not using it because I do not want to risk any cracks or scratches. Second, the case must not hinder my typing ability, nor inconvenience me when I need to charge the battery or use the earphones. All ports must be accessible without the need to remove the iPhone from the case. And third, it MUST look stylish.

The case is the IDOX for the iPhone 3Gs, and here are the reasons why I am loving it:
1. Without a doubt this case protects my iPhone's display screen. The clam-shell design has a hard cover that is securely hinged and molded perfectly to fit my iPhone. It also covers the entire display screen when closed.
2. All ports are accessible, even when the case is closed.
3. The camera lens is completely covered. And while some could find this inconvenient because it entails taking the phone out of the case whenever the camera is in use, I prefer having the lens protected from dust or lint whenever I am not using it.
4. The case also serves as an iPhone stand. This is definitely an innovative feature! I could set up my iPhone to easily display photos. I can also place it on my night stand or desk so it can function as an alarm clock, ipod player, or speaker phone. And when I am traveling I can place it on any flat surface and watch movies or read my ebooks. These and more make it absolutely convenient!
